1066 update
England got a bum deal in the first attempt of 1066. This should now be better balanced with a new SC in Norfolk (formerly East Anglia on the board) & a new sea territory, Central North Sea. Enjoy!

Favorite Party Game?
Just got Pictionary for Christmas, and I've had my eye on Cards Against Humanity, so I was wondering what you guys usually play with people (besides Diplomacy, of course) when you've got a good group.

Depending on your group size and interest in learning potentially complicated and long board games, there are tons to choose from. Personally, I enjoy Euro board games with my friends. A favorite of mine is BANG! Lots of rules and complicated when you start off, but its a blast to play. If you are looking for milder games, some I can think of off the top of my head would be Cards Against Humanity, Balderdash (or Fictionary as Mertvaya Ruka called it), and Train of Thought.
